Quiet start to the meetings
By now, everyone has a feel for the set-up here at the Marriott and the adjoining Westin, which along with a convention center across the street are serving as the setting for this year’s Winter Meetings. The Starbucks have all been identified and so have the bars. Now all we need is some action to occupy the dozens of scribes, scouts and baseball officials milling around the lobby.
Mariners GM Jack Zduriencik and fellow former Brewers associates Tony Blengino and Tom McNamara spent some time in the lobby this morning, as did Cubs skipper Lou Piniella (who probably has Milton Bradley on his mind) and his White Sox counterpart, Ozzie Guillen. No sign of the Brewers’ crew this morning.
